Ingredients
Scale
- 4 medium Fresh nectarines
- 3 tablespoons Unsalted butter
- 2 tablespoons Honey
- 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
- 1 cup Heavy cream
- 2 tablespoons Powdered sugar
- 1/2 cup Raw pistachios
- 1/3 cup Roasted hazelnuts
- 2 tablespoons Sesame seeds
- 1 teaspoon Ground cumin
- 1 teaspoon Ground coriander
- 1/2 teaspoon Ground c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on Sea salt
- 1/4 teaspoon Black pepper

Notes
Choose ripe but firm nectarines to ensure they do not fall apart during roasting. Keep cream very cold until the last moment so it whips faster and holds peaks better. Serve immediately after assembly to maintain the crispy texture of the spice blend.
